原文:Python List Comprehension

一 使用List Comprehension的好處 在了解Python的List Comprehension之前,我們習慣使用for循環創建列表,比如下面的例子: 可是在Python中,我們有更簡潔,可讀性更好的方式創建列表,就是List Comprehension: 我們也可以用map加上lambda實現上述List Comprehension的功能: 上面三個代碼段的功能類似,除了map函數 ...

2018-06-01 17:14 0 1910 推薦指數:

查看詳情

Python的遞推式構造列表(List comprehension

介紹 我們在上一章學習了“Lambda 操作, Filter, Reduce 和 Map”, 但相對於map, filter, reduce 和lamdba, Guido van Rossum更喜歡用遞推式構造列表(List comprehension)。在這一章我們將會涵蓋遞推式構造列表 ...

Thu May 28 08:51:00 CST 2015 1 15096
列表解析式(List Comprehension

1、列表解析 List Comprehension  舉例:生成一個列表,元素0~9,對每一個元素自增1后求平方返回新列表   語法    [返回值 for 元素 in 可迭代對象 if 條件]    使用中括號[],內部是for循環,if條件語句可選    返回一個 ...

Thu Apr 09 04:03:00 CST 2020 1 1537
pythonlist

pythonlist是一個序列(字符串和元組也是序列),有下標,可以切片,拼接等,list也是一個可變數據類型,即可以修改list的元素的值且list的內存地址不變。 一.list的定義和遍歷使用 list使用中括號[]來定義 由<class 'list'>可看 ...

Sat Apr 27 05:03:00 CST 2019 0 486
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M